Smart Homes: The AI-Powered Living Experience
One of the most visible impacts of AI will be in our homes. Smart home systems are evolving from simple voice commands to predictive environments that anticipate our needs. Imagine waking up to a home that has already adjusted the temperature to your preference, brewed your coffee at the perfect moment, and curated a morning news briefing based on your interests.
These AI systems will learn from our behaviors and patterns, creating personalized living experiences. Key developments include:
- Predictive maintenance that alerts homeowners about potential issues before they become problems
- Energy optimization that reduces utility costs by learning usage patterns
- Enhanced security systems with facial recognition and anomaly detection
- Automated inventory management for groceries and household supplies
The integration of AI in home automation represents a significant shift toward more efficient and comfortable living spaces. As these technologies become more affordable, they will transition from luxury items to standard features in modern homes.
Healthcare Revolution: AI as Your Personal Medical Assistant
Healthcare stands to benefit tremendously from AI advancements. Future medical AI systems will provide personalized health monitoring and preventive care that was previously unimaginable. Wearable devices will evolve from simple fitness trackers to comprehensive health companions that can detect early signs of medical conditions.
Key healthcare applications include:
- Continuous health monitoring with real-time analysis of vital signs
- Personalized treatment plans based on genetic profiles and lifestyle data
- Early disease detection through pattern recognition in medical data
- Virtual health assistants that provide 24/7 medical guidance
These advancements in healthcare technology will democratize access to quality medical care, particularly in underserved areas. AI-powered diagnostic tools will assist healthcare professionals in making more accurate decisions, ultimately improving patient outcomes.
Transportation and Mobility: The AI-Driven Commute
The transportation sector is undergoing a radical transformation thanks to AI. Self-driving vehicles are just the beginning of how AI will reshape our daily commutes and travel experiences. Future transportation systems will feature:
- Fully autonomous vehicles that communicate with each other to optimize traffic flow
- Smart city infrastructure that adjusts traffic signals in real-time
- Predictive maintenance for public transportation systems
- Personalized route optimization based on real-time conditions
These innovations will not only make transportation more efficient but also significantly safer. AI systems can process vast amounts of data from multiple sources simultaneously, enabling them to make split-second decisions that human drivers might miss.

Ethical Considerations and Challenges
As AI becomes more integrated into daily life, several important considerations must be addressed. Privacy concerns, data security, and algorithmic bias represent significant challenges that require careful management. Key areas of focus include:
- Developing robust data protection frameworks
- Ensuring transparency in AI decision-making processes
- Addressing potential job displacement through retraining programs
- Establishing ethical guidelines for AI development and deployment
Successful integration of AI into society will require collaboration between technologists, policymakers, and the public to ensure these technologies benefit everyone equitably.
